“Hindu students recite ‘Surah-Al-Fatiha,’ and wear Hijab as dress code — All you need to know about ‘Ganga Jamna School’”, Organiser, June 15, 2023:
Since the last week of May, the city of Madhya Pradesh, Damoh is making it to national television almost every day. It all started with a poster from the private school called, ‘Ganga Jamna’ which was shared and called out in large numbers for making Hindu and Jain students wear Hijab compulsorily. The matter turned so big that the Chief Minister of the State had to give assurance of a detailed investigation from one of his rallies. After rounds of notices and conferences, a case has been registered and as many as three people including the principal of the school have been arrested.
To get the things in detail, this correspondent went to Damoh almost 250 kilometres from the state capital Bhopal this week (June 13). The visit involved meeting Hindu families whose children were studying at the school and getting into the reasoning of why they sent their children to a school that is analogous to a Madarsa.
Amidst all this, Vimal Soni’s 11-year-old son, Kamal (name changed) has become a centre of attraction to all the media persons. Kamal recites ayats and ‘Surah-Al-Fatiha’ frequently despite being a Hindu. Not only Vimal’s son but there are as many as 350 (out of 1200 students at the school) Hindu students who were offering the same prayers at the school and were passively moving towards Islam.
